Consider looking at the Powermaster Catalog. Unlike others, Powermaster list alternator output ratings at idle (2200 -2400 alternator rpm speed) and actual dimensions of the alternator case. 100 amp alternators are maximum rated. The one on my race car will do that at idle. PowerMaster mem....i never charge battery at the track...... NEVER!!! | |||
